Getting Going with Woodworking

Before diving into woodworking jobs, one must begin by gathering the vital tools. For those on a restricted spending plan, hand tools can be a cost effective and efficient alternative. A standard collection of tools consists of a hand saw, knives, a club, jack plane, and a sanding block. Visiting home improvement shops in Rock or anywhere else to get these devices is a must.

Clothes Drying Rack

A clothes drying out rack is a sensible addition to any laundry room. Utilize your woodworking abilities to build a durable and space-saving rack. With just a few wooden dowels, hooks, and screws, you can develop a functional drying out solution that fits your demands.

Wood Pallet Dog Crate

Wood pallets, typically available free of cost or at an inexpensive, can be transformed right into functional storage space dog crates. These rustic dog crates are excellent for arranging things in cooking areas in Longmont or as decorative components in any space. Sand the pallets, assemble them using nails or screws, and add a layer of paint or stain to boost their aesthetic charm.

Additional Tips for Woodworking on a Budget plan

In addition to the job ideas discussed above, here are some suggestions to help you conserve money while going after woodworking:

Discover Scrap Lawns and Reclaimed Wood

Scrap backyards and salvage facilities can be treasure troves for woodworkers on a budget. They frequently have discounted or free scrap timber items that can be repurposed for different tasks. In addition, recovered wood from old furniture or structures adds a special character to your developments while being affordable.

Upcycle and Repurpose

Seek creative methods to repurpose existing items or furniture items. For example, an old wood ladder can be changed into a rustic shelf, or salvaged pallets can be become fashionable wall art. By reimagining and repurposing materials, you can conserve cash while adding unique touches to your tasks.
